Blue Clarity is seeking a highly experienced Senior Procurement Analyst / Program Manager (PM) to lead the execution and oversight of a major acquisition support contract for the Air National Guard Readiness Center (ANGRC). This position serves as the single point of accountability for all program operations, team performance, and deliverable quality under the Acquisition & Contract Management Support Services (ACMSS) program.
The PM will oversee multiple acquisition workstreams—including procurement package development, acquisition forecasting, process automation, and performance reporting—ensuring compliance with FAR, DFARS, and NGB policies. The role requires strong leadership, deep understanding of federal acquisition lifecycle management, and proven experience implementing process improvements that reduce Procurement Administrative Lead Time (PALT).
Program Leadership and Oversight
- Serve as the authorized Contract Manager (CM) responsible for daily program operations, deliverable quality, and schedule compliance.
- Lead a multidisciplinary team supporting ~300 annual contract and agreement actions, ensuring efficient task execution and consistent results.
- Act as the primary liaison between BlueThree, the Contracting Officer (KO), and the Contracting Officer’s Representative (COR), ensuring transparency, timely communications, and proactive issue resolution.
- Oversee development, implementation, and updates of required deliverables including the Quality Control Plan (QCP), Contract Forecast, Property Management Plan, and Monthly Reports.
Acquisition Strategy and Governance
- Direct the preparation and review of complex procurement documentation (SOW, IGCE, Market Research, J&A, QASP, etc.).
- Implement category management principles and performance-based acquisition strategies aligned with ANGRC and NGB-AQ objectives.
- Govern PRS and KPI dashboards to ensure data integrity and measurable outcomes across acquisition functions.
- Lead Monthly Acquisition Review Working Groups (MAR WG), Contracting Requirements Validation Reviews (CRVR), and other senior-level meetings, producing timely and accurate documentation.
Risk, Quality, and Compliance Management
- Develop, monitor, and maintain internal performance and risk management systems.
- Ensure adherence to all security and compliance requirements including NIST SP 800-171, CUI, OPSEC, and AT Level I training mandates.
- Maintain audit-ready documentation in SharePoint and Paperless Contract File (PCF) systems per DFARS 4.8.
- Conduct regular internal audits to validate adherence to the Quality Assurance Surveillance Plan (QASP).
Leadership and Stakeholder Engagement
- Mentor, train, and evaluate project personnel and subcontractor performance.
- Manage subcontractor task integration and performance metrics in alignment with contractual requirements.
- Facilitate coordination among divisions and external mission partners to ensure acquisition readiness and timely submission of procurement actions.
- Required Qualifications
- Education: Bachelor’s degree in business, public administration, or a related field. Master’s degree or PMP preferred.
- Experience: Minimum of 10 years of DoD or federal acquisition experience, including 5 years at a headquarters or major command level.
- Knowledge Areas: Advanced expertise in FAR, DFARS, AFARS, and NGB-AQ acquisition policy.
- Leadership Skills: Demonstrated ability to manage contract staff, direct workflows, and ensure quality across multiple concurrent projects.
- Technical Skills: Familiarity with PIEE, EDA, VCE, SharePoint, Power BI, and data dashboarding.
- Security: Must hold or be eligible for a Tier 1 (T1) background investigation and Common Access Card (CAC).
- Certifications: DAWIA/FAC-C Level II or III preferred; PMP desirable.
